TUESDAY 14 NOVEMBER 2017

 

To celebrate International Education Week #IEW2017, Tunisia-TESOL and the Embassy ELT Team invite English teachers to a FREE workshop: Assessment for Student Learning: Prospects of Implementation in the ELT Classroom, by Dr. Asma Maaoui followed by a talk about Fighting Procrastination by Irina Cordall.

About the speakers:
Asma Maaoui is an Assistant Professor of English at the University of Tunis. She holds a PhD in Applied Linguistics and has been teaching English since 1996. She has served as an active member of Tunisia TESOL since its creation and is currently its president. Her main research interests include language assessment, reading comprehension teaching and assessment, English for Business Purposes, technology-based instruction and assessment, self-regulated learning and test-taker strategies.
Irina Cordall is originally from Russia and has lived in the USA, Vietnam and Tunisia. She has over eight years of teaching experience gained in a variety of environments, including public and private schools, universities, online and by delivering bespoke courses within companies’ premises. During this time, Irina has taught all age groups, from four to 84 and has helped learners of all levels, from beginner to advanced. She has taught General and Business English, EAP, ESP, and exam English.
